Caralyn Cooley to become new CPO at FanDuel

Cooley will be responsible for the continued acceleration of FanDuel’s people strategy, reflecting the operator’s growth trajectory.
FanDuel has announced the appointment of Caralyn Cooley as the operator’s new Chief People Officer where she will report to FanDuel CEO Amy Howe.
Cooley will join FanDuel’s executive leadership team and will be responsible for the continued acceleration of FanDuel’s people strategy, reflecting the company’s growth trajectory.
“I am very excited to welcome Caralyn to FanDuel. Throughout her distinguished career Caralyn has held global roles building highly effective people teams that drive performance and reflect the needs of today’s diverse corporate culture,” Howe said.
“Her energy and passion for sports and the gaming sector made her an ideal fit, and her arrival strengthens our executive leadership team.”
Cooley most recently served as EVP and CPO for Bowery Farming, a US vertical farming company that designs and builds smart indoor environments.
During her tenure, Cooley built a talent model to scale globally, designed a total compensation strategy for all levels of the company, created a holistic diversity, equity and inclusion program and led Bowery’s business continuity response during the Covid-19 pandemic.
For FanDuel, she will assume leadership of the operator’s people organization inclusive of human resources, talent acquisition, DE&I, organizational effectiveness as well as handling employee branding, training, learning and development, compensation and benefits in service to FanDuel’s casino, sports and operations business units.
On September 13, FanDuel held its Play Well Day as part of Responsible Gaming Education Month in September. This was the third year the company has set aside a day to affirm its commitment to responsible gaming and to supporting its players.
As part of the celebration, the operator held events across its offices in collaboration with Epic Global Solutions. FanDuel hosted live experience sessions to raise awareness “and humanize the issue of problem gambling.”
